Lamar Odom Opens Up for First Time About Brothel Incident

Kevork Djansezian/Getty Images(LOS ANGELES) — More than a year after being found unconscious in a legal Nevada brothel, Lamar Odom is opening up about the past incident, his life now and more.

Odom had been using cocaine and sexual enhancement drugs in October 2015 when he was found by brothel employees and rushed to a nearby hospital, a police report stated at the time of the incident.

The former basketball star said Friday on The Doctors that the last thing he remembered before waking up in the hospital was “thinking I was going to just rest a bit.” He had been staying at a residence at the brothel.

“I wasn’t in a good place mentally … before the incident happened,” he told The Doctors‘ Travis Stork. “My wife at the time, we were going through some things,” he said of his ex Khloe Kardashian. Kardashian is now dating Cleveland Cavaliers player Tristan Thompson, she’s said in various interviews.

After the hospital, Odom was moved to a rehabilitation facility to fully recover from the incident physically.

“I was in a dark place,” he said about that time. “I guess they say everything happens for a reason. So, I guess the reason is I’m here and I can tell the story.”

Odom was initially in a coma for days before opening his eyes and he told Stork he didn’t know it was that serious until Kardashian told him.

“I couldn’t even speak at the time, I couldn’t talk,” he added about his physical state. “I was scared.”

The interview ends with Stork asking Odom if he’s still using, but the show has chosen to hold the rest of the segment and the interview until after Odom allegedly finishes rehab, Stork told the audience. A request for comment or confirmation from Odom’s rep that he is in rehab has not been returned to ABC News.

The interview was conducted a few weeks back, according to Stork.
